Freedoom is a project to use the DOOM source code which is open source and recreate all graphics and sounds from scratch so that it won't be copyrighted any more - this way everybody can plays DOOM legally for free.
There is a basic thing it seems I haven't told in the forums, only to Camper this far (though I think I posted it in the forums here too): in a map, weapons are put by number, regardless of class, i.e. a weapon lying on the ground is always a #3, no matter which class wants to pick it up. The same weapon even looks different depending on which class you play at that moment. The same could be done to the ammo, it could look something else for each class, like ammo boxes for the marine, spellbooks for the mage, holy scrolls for the cleric, etc. But even if we leave the mana cubes as universal ammo, I don't see why it can't power a shotgun just as well as a magic axe, a longbow or a summon spell. <!-- s;) --><img src="{SMILIES_PATH}/icon_wink.gif" alt=";)" title="Wink" /><!-- s;) -->
Tome of Power: it isn't planned for Korax Arena, at least not at the moment, which I know is a shame but building up an arsenal of up to 54 weapons (6 classes x 9 weapons, Discs of Repulsion is universal) and balancing them is already an insane amount of work - so making secondary weapon functions or special tomed-up features would complicated matters immensely. Of course the Tome could be nothing but a Quad Damage, if you think it makes sense that could be done pretty easily.
